      Second LD, dissapointed :/

      I'm quite sure this dream was in the earlier of my REM cycles because I only remembered it when I opened my DJ to write down my prewaking dream.

      The only thing I remember is becoming semi lucid. I don't remember the dream setting at all but I remember doing a nose RC. The sensation of pinching my nose but still breathing was incredible, and I became semi lucid. I looked around a lot to try and stabilize the dream instead of using tactile methods(fail), all the while thinking to myself "This is a dream. This is a dream."

      As far as I can remember all I did was stand there looking around. The dream was really unrealistic, my vision was almost pixely and blurry which is probably why the lucidity only lasted like 10 seconds. But I'm glad my subconscious actually used a RC, that was the first time it's happened.
